The term refers to a standard developed by the Society of Automotive Engineers (SAE). This mandate requires automakers to support reprogramming of their ECUs (Engine Control Units) using a generic pass-thru device. This means that, in theory, a single J2534-compliant tool can program vehicles from various manufacturers.

The Mini VCI is a popular aftermarket implementation of this standard, designed specifically to interface with , Toyota’s proprietary diagnostic software.
